Wehrlein to drive for Force India in Barcelona
Mercedes reserve driver Pascal Wehrlein will drive for the Force India team at this week's second pre-season test in Barcelona and on another two occasions this season. The 20-year-old took up the role of reserve for Mercedes last year and was rumoured to be in the running to drive Force India's 2014 car on at least one of the test days. The team has now confirmed he will drive on Thursday and Saturday, whilst Sergio Perez will drive on Friday and Nico Hulkenberg on Sunday. Mercedes motorsport boss Toto Wolff believes the opportunity will provide good experience for Wehrlein, whilst also providing Force India with valuable feedback.
